The HOWUM 2026 is a 30-mile ultra in mid-Wales, starting and finishing in Llanidloes. The route forms the Heartlands of Wales circular, merging four trails—the Sarn, Glyndwr’s Way, Severn Way and Wye Valley Walk—toward the source of the River Severn and back, with no time limits. Rasus y Bannau (The Beacon Races) are three long-distance mountain running challenges organized by Run Walk Crawl, starting and finishing in Brecon and circling the Bannau Brycheiniog National Park. Westcountry Ultra 100 Miler is Albion Running's signature 100-mile event, held in Somerset, England. The race fuses the Flat 50 and Hilly 50 routes into one epic loop from Taunton to Minehead, largely along the Taunton–Bridgwater canal path, River Parrett Trail, and West Somerset Coast Path.
